Output e667d31bb4a533a18f28a4d2d265d4a2aea52323ea46bce55e06580215253335:432

value
5831
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b95e2b60c18bcb6a053857e4875176328c9e3056b5b7d1696eefe17569196d92
address
bc1ph90zkcxp309k5pfc2ljgw5tkx2xfuvzkkkmaz6twalsh26gedkfqyw9zge
transaction
e667d31bb4a533a18f28a4d2d265d4a2aea52323ea46bce55e06580215253335